Statement to voters

Richard Davis is the Parliamentary Candidate for Battersea. He is committed to changing Britain's future, to stopping a disastrous hard Brexit and fighting for the rights of all EU citizens living in the UK. Richard is a passionate Liberal Democrat and long-time Battersea resident, working hard to give everyone in his local community a fair chance in life. He has campaigned on a wide range of issues including maintaining local libraries and keeping free playground access. Richard has previously been a school governor at High View Primary and was a Director of CASE, a charity which aims to improve the scientific health of the UK. Richard's background is as a research scientist, he has collaborated on research topics with teams across the EU as well as working in labs in Holland and Cyprus. This has given him first-hand knowledge of the benefits of co-operation with our European neighbours, and like 75% of Battersea residents he voted Remain. Richard is pledged to fighting to stop hardliners trying to force the UK over a cliff-edge of hard Brexit.
